According to a Harris poll, about 2% of Americans play online poker or gamble at an online casino at least once a month. Only a small number gamble on sports. The most popular online casino games are online poker and casino games. And two-thirds of poker players prefer to play Texas Hold ‘Em. The least popular poker games are Omaha and five-card draw.

Online gambling has caused a controversy in the United States. It is illegal in some countries, including the United States, and some of the states have banned it. In California, online gambling was prohibited until 1998. In Antigua and Barbuda, the government of the island nation said online gambling was harming its economy. A World Trade Organization panel ruled in 2004 that the United States was violating the rules of international trade agreements by banning online gambling. However, the United States refused to change its position on online gambling.

Most online gambling sites offer free play to entice new visitors or help them practice. To play for real money, you will need to register with a specific website. To do this, you’ll need to provide some personal information and create a username and password. Once you have an account, you can use your credit or debit card or use an online payment service to make a deposit. Some sites will also accept wire transfers or electronic checks.

While some countries have prohibited online gambling, many others have made it legal. In France, internet gambling is permitted in some places. In the Mohawk Territory of Kahnawake, it’s regulated by the Kahnawake Gaming Commission, which is responsible for issuing gaming licences to many online casinos and poker rooms. The commission aims to ensure that the operations of licensed online gambling organizations are fair.

Some online casinos offer sign-up bonuses of up to 20%. However, you must wager a minimum of two to three times the bonus to withdraw your winnings. Some sites also offer prizes for repeat customers. Winnings are usually deposited into your online account, but you can also get a certified check mailed to you.
